117.info
人生若只如初见

php event如何与数据库交互

要将PHP事件与数据库交互,您需要使用数据库连接来执行查询和操作。以下是一些基本的步骤:

  1. 建立数据库连接:首先,您需要使用PHP中的数据库连接函数(如mysqli_connect()或PDO)来连接到您的数据库。您需要提供数据库的主机名,用户名,密码和数据库名称。

  2. 执行查询:一旦连接到数据库,您可以使用执行查询语句来检索或更新数据库中的数据。您可以使用mysqli_query()或PDO的prepare()和execute()方法来执行SQL查询。

  3. 处理结果:一旦查询被执行,您可以使用mysqli_fetch_array()或PDO的fetch()方法来从结果集中检索数据。您可以将数据显示在网页上或进行其他操作。

  4. 关闭连接:最后,不要忘记使用mysqli_close()或PDO的close()方法来关闭数据库连接,以避免资源泄漏。

以下是一个简单的示例,演示如何与数据库交互:

 0) {
    while($row = mysqli_fetch_assoc($result)) {
        echo "ID: " . $row["id"]. " - Name: " . $row["name"]. "
"; } } else { echo "0 results"; } // 关闭连接 mysqli_close($conn); ?>

请注意,这只是一个简单的示例,您可以根据您的需要更改和扩展代码。确保对数据库操作进行适当的验证和防御,以避免SQL注入等安全问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ef2eAzsIAgJWAFY.html

推荐文章

  • PHP正则表达式的常见错误

    忘记使用反斜杠转义特殊字符:在正则表达式中,一些特殊字符(如$、^、*、+、?、{、[、(、)、|、\、/)需要使用反斜杠进行转义,否则会产生错误。 忘记使用定界符...

  • PHP正则表达式匹配技巧有哪些

    PHP正则表达式匹配技巧包括: 使用^和$分别匹配字符串的开头和结尾,确保匹配整个字符串。
    使用元字符.匹配任意一个字符,使用*匹配0个或多个前面的字符,使...

  • 如何理解PHP正则的预查功能

    PHP正则的预查功能是一种特殊的正则表达式语法,在匹配字符串时进行非捕获性的预先判断。预查功能可以帮助我们在匹配字符串时,仅当满足某些条件时才进行匹配,而...

  • PHP正则表达式的回溯问题解析

    在PHP中,正则表达式的回溯问题指的是正则表达式引擎在匹配字符串时,发生了过多的回溯操作,导致匹配速度变慢甚至发生性能问题的情况。回溯是指在匹配过程中,正...

  • php event的异常处理机制

    在PHP中,可以使用try-catch语句来捕获和处理异常。当代码块中的代码抛出异常时,try块中的代码会停止执行,然后转到catch块中,这里可以处理异常。下面是一个简...

  • 如何测试php文件锁的可靠性

    测试PHP文件锁的可靠性可以通过编写一个简单的测试脚本来进行。以下是一个示例测试脚本: 你可以多次运行这个脚本来模拟多个进程同时尝试获取文件锁的情况,以测...

  • php文件锁在并发环境下的表现

    在并发环境下,使用PHP文件锁可以帮助确保在多个进程或线程同时访问同一个文件时,只有一个进程或线程能够对文件进行写操作,避免数据被并发读写引发的问题。具体...

  • php文件锁是否支持分布式系统

    PHP文件锁通常是通过flock()函数实现的,它是针对单个进程的文件锁定机制,不支持分布式系统。
    对于分布式系统,通常需要使用其他的机制来实现分布式锁,比...